Plugin authors: as of this morning, Glyphharbor no longer fetches third-party fonts at build time. All approved families are vendored into the platform bundle and served from our asset tier. Remove any remote font declarations from your plugin manifests; builds referencing external font sources will fail validation starting next release. Subsetting is handled centrally, so drop local subsetting steps too. Licensing review covered every vendored family. The asset service now runs with the following configuration values.

config for kafof-bawef:
holath:
  log_level: debug
  metrics_host: metrics.holath.qorvelsys.internal
  pin: 2191
  pool_size: 32

Re: Retirement of the Stonebriar product line

Stonebriar sales have declined for five consecutive quarters and support costs now exceed contribution margin. The retirement plan is staged: new orders close end of Q2, existing contracts honoured through their terms, and spares stocked for twenty-four months. Sales leads should steer prospects toward the Ashgrove range; migration incentives are already approved. Customer comms are drafted and awaiting legal sign-off. The forward strategy behind this decision is set out in the note below.

confidential, yafog-hagug: Gross margin on Druix came in at 10 percent against a plan of 15 percent. Only 5 of the 80 pilot accounts renewed Druix, so a churn review is set for October 1.

Subject: Quickstore 4.2 — bloom filter now fronts the KV layer

Plugin authors: starting with this release, Quickstore places a bloom filter ahead of the key-value store. Negative lookups return faster; false positives fall through safely. No API changes are required on your side. Verify your plugin against the staging build referenced below.

session token of fahif-tadup = htk3_9c7

## BANNER-412: Consent banner blocks checkout on Merrow mobile web

Severity: high. Blocks 2.4 rollout.

Repro:
1. Open Merrow storefront on mobile viewport, region set to Veldany.
2. Dismiss consent banner.
3. Tap checkout — banner reappears and overlays the pay button.

Expected: dismissal persists for session. Actual: reappears every navigation. To pull rollout flags from the config service, authenticate with the bearer token below:

portal login ticket: eyJhbGciOiJIUzI1NiIsInR5cCI6IkpXVCJ9.eyJzdWIiOiIMjvRAf3PEFIn0.nuv9gjixLtnr